Table 2.
Unadjusted and adjusted multinomial logistic regression results (relative risk ratio with 95% confidence intervals) showing the association between parental engagement at wave 1 and subsequent delayed marriage of girls at wave 2 in Uttar Pradesh and Bihar, UDAYA (n = 5967).
Parental engagement | Model I: Age at marriage (compared with early married girls) | Model II: Age at marriage (compared with early married girls)a | ||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Married 18-19 years | Married 20-22 years | Unmarried girls | Married 18-19 years | Married 20-22 years | Unmarried girls | |
Discussed school performance | 0.82* (0.67, 0.99) | 0.60** (0.47, 0.76) | 1.59** (1.38, 1.85) | 0.62** (0.50, 0.77) | 0.50** (0.38, 0.66) | 1.33** (1.11, 1.60) |
Discussed friendship | 1.10 (0.90, 1.36) | 1.72** (1.32, 2.25) | 1.37** (1.17, 1.62) | 1.03 (0.83, 1.28) | 1.62** (1.22, 2.15) | 1.37** (1.15, 1.64) |
Discussed physical changes/menstruation | 0.84 (0.68, 1.03) | 0.61** (0.47, 0.79) | 0.74** (0.62, 0.87) | 0.88 (0.71, 1.09) | 0.67** (0.51, 0.88) | 0.80* (0.67, 0.95) |
Discussed how pregnancy occurs | 0.83 (0.43, 1.58) | 1.66 (0.84, 3.26) | 1.63* (1.02, 2.60) | 0.76 (0.39, 1.47) | 1.49 (0.74, 2.99) | 1.50 (0.92, 2.46) |
Parents know about free time spending | 1.37* (1.04, 1.79) | 1.58* (1.09, 2.29) | 1.34** (1.10, 1.65) | 1.18 (0.90, 1.56) | 1.24 (0.84, 1.82) | 1.08 (0.87, 1.34) |
Can talk about personal things with parents | 1.66** (1.34, 2.06) | 1.89** (1.42, 2.51) | 1.60** (1.36, 1.88) | 1.39** (1.12, 1.73) | 1.31 (0.98, 1.76) | 1.29** (1.09, 1.54) |
*p < 0.05.
**p < 0.01.
Model adjusted for residence, caste, religion, years of schooling, household wealth, state, and social/digital connectivity.
